The 4 enablers of Employee Engagement with Jo Dodds
28/02/2025 Duración: 42minMatt Phelan sits down to discuss with Jo Dodds her career and work with Engage for Success. Jo defines the 4 enablers of Employee Engagement and how you can use them to drive employee engagement.The Four Enablers of Engagement are 1) Strategic Narrative · 2) Organisational Integrity · 3) Engaging Managers · 4) Employee Voice.Matt asks Jo the following questions What makes you happy?Tell us about your career?How do you find a career with purpose ?How did you get involved in engage for success?Can you give us a brief summary of the Engage for success 4 enablers ???What have you learnt about Strategic narrative?How do you Engage managers?Are there any key lessons for listening to voice of the Employee? What is Organisational integrity and why is it important?Jo in her own wordsI'm an employee engagement consultant. I also coach, speak, train, consult and facilitate depending on the need. "Could've been an email" with Dr Carrie Goucher
21/02/2025 Duración: 45minAbout this episodeMatt Phelan and Dr Carrie Goucher discuss the fascinating world of meeting culture, how it evolved, why it is a problem and how we can fix it. About Dr Carrie GoucherDr Carrie Goucher is a leading expert on fixing broken collaboration and helping organisations move faster by rethinking how they meet, decide and execute.With a PhD in Meeting Culture from Cambridge, she coined the term “Collabureaucracy" to describe the invisible friction slowing companies down. As the creator of FewerFasterBolder, Carrie helps global brands, governments, and high-growth teams cut meeting overload, streamline collaboration and drive real progress.You can get a free technique or idea for collaborating faster every Thursday in her FrictionFree newsletter - www.FewerFasterBolder.com/frictionfreeQuestions in this episodeWhat makes you happy Carrie?Why do companies ignore the issue of bad meetings?What is the cost of bad meetings?What is Collabureaucracy? How employee feedback led to £10 million in annual savings...
08/12/2024 Duración: 48minWhat if the secret to saving your company £10 million a year isn't a new product or a cost-cutting measure, but simply listening to your people?This week, we're joined by Kevin Green, Chief People Officer at First Bus, the UK's second-largest bus company. As an experienced business and HR leader, and author of the best-selling book Competitive People Strategy, Kevin is uniquely qualified to discuss how HR can drive tangible business transformation.In this episode, Kevin Green explains how HR often gets overcomplicated and why it's vital to measure its impact. He shares a groundbreaking case study from First Bus, revealing how a focus on employee engagement led to a remarkable £10 million in annual savings. Kevin breaks down his approach, providing a clear playbook for HR leaders to secure investment and get their ideas on the executive agenda.He also shares his vision for the future of HR, emphasising a shift from administration to strategic business partnership.

A review of the last podcast episode with Matt Stannard and Sharon Kennedy
10/10/2024 Duración: 23minMatt P, Matt S and Sharon discuss the previous episode (please scroll back) that was 100% AI generated. Matt shared his observations that: - The AI consumed over 100 research studies but didn’t reference them all. - This tech could be a really useful learning aid if audio is your preference. For example you could take any document, upload it and listen to it back as a podcast - Apparently one of the most listened to podcasts in retail is now built and read by AI. It’s called something like Retail Economics. - I think we are entering a world where we need to tag content as including AI. A bit like we do with food ingredients. - I find the AI having a point of view discombobulating. As a listener of podcasts it’s the POV I come for. I want to trust it due to the rich research I’ve fed it but I struggle to trust it. Is this a generational thing?
